
Jacob Daniel Eddlemon
The Caldwell County Communications Center received a 911 call at 730 am from a resident in Granite Falls who told dispatchers that her Volkswagen Passat was stolen from Hillside Ave in Granite Falls and there was a tracker in place on the vehicle. Caldwell Deputies located the stolen vehicle traveling north on Highway 321 in Granite Falls. They began a pursuit that continued through Deal Mill Rd into the Oak Hill Community to Wilkesboro Blvd. Stop sticks were deployed damaging the tires near the Starcross Road, but Eddlemon continued driving. He eventually came to a stop near Chick Fil-A and was taken into custody at 7:57 am.
Eddlemon is charged by the Caldwell County Sheriff’s Office with Felony Flee to Elude Arrest and Possession of a Stolen Motor Vehicle. He received a $75,000 dollar secured bond. Eddlemon is believed to be responsible for more incidents in Ashe, Wilkes and Burke counties. He also has charges pending from the Granite Falls Police Department.
